But the landlord can't charge you for utilities used by other tenants. You could sue the landlord for breach of contract. The problem is how do you determine how much in utilities you used versus everyone else. In other words, you must prove how much you were damaged. At best, you can only estimate that but it's still worth taking to court. Make sure when you move out, that you don't give the landlord any reason to keep your security deposit too.
